Probable cause
An engine failure due to improper maintenance installation. A factor was: lack of suitable terrain for the forced landing.

Analysis narrative
While in low level cruise after takeoff on a aerial application flight, a mechanical loss of power occurred. The pilot conducted a forced landing on a hillside in mountainous/hilly terrain. A post impact fire destroyed the aircraft. The power loss was due to loss of engine oil as a result of improper maintenance.
